Arbitrary environment-variable injection via unsanitized null bytes
Published Mar 2, 2023 · Updated Mar 5, 2025
Code injection in affected GitHub Enterprise Server releases allows remote authenticated users to set arbitrary environment variables. GitHub Actions on Windows runners improperly sanitizes null bytes in one environment-variable value, allowing that value to define additional variables. Exploitation requires existing permission to control environment-variable values used by an Actions workflow; published evidence establishes alteration of the runner process environment but not command execution.

Is a vulnerable build present?
Compare these published version ranges with your installed build and any vendor patches.
- Affected versionversion=3.4.0 <=3.4.14 changes=[{"at":"3.4.15","status":"unaffected"}]
- Affected versionversion=3.5.0 <=3.5.11 changes=[{"at":"3.5.12","status":"unaffected"}]
- Affected versionversion=3.6.0 <=3.6.7 changes=[{"at":"3.6.8","status":"unaffected"}]
- Affected versionversion=3.7.0 <=3.7.4 changes=[{"at":"3.7.5","status":"unaffected"}]
